The Douglas County Sheriff’s Office is hoping to reunite a “substantial amount of cash” with the unlucky person who lost it.
The money was found in an envelope at a Highlands Ranch restaurant, in the vicinity of Westridge, in September.
“In order to claim this money we will require that certain details be known in order to ensure the rightful owner be identified,” the office said.
The owner of the money is asked to contact the Douglas County Sheriff’s Office Property and Evidence Unit at (303) 660-7558.
